Get Your Legal Questions Answered by Elia Law Firm APC`s Injury Attorneys in San Diego
Question | Answer |
---|---|
1. Can I sue for personal injury if I was injured on someone else`s property? | Oh, absolutely! If you sustained an injury due to the negligence of the property owner, you may have grounds for a personal injury lawsuit. The key is to prove that the property owner failed to maintain a safe environment, leading to your injury. |
2. How much compensation can I receive for a slip and fall accident? | Well, amount compensation slip fall accident varies depending severity injuries impact life. Factors such as med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ering will all be taken into account when determining the compensation amount. |
3. What is the statute of limitations for filing a personal injury claim in San Diego? | Ah, the statute of limitations for filing a personal injury claim in San Diego is typically two years from the date of the injury. However, it`s important to consult with a knowledgeable attorney to ensure you don`t miss the filing deadline. |
4. Can I file a wrongful death claim if a family member died in a car accident? | Yes, you can pursue a wrongful death claim if a family member died in a car accident caused by someone else`s negligence. This type of claim seeks compensation for the financial and emotional losses suffered due to the untimely death of a loved one. |
5. What steps take injured car accident? | After being injured in a car accident, it`s crucial to seek medical attention, gather evidence such as photos and witness statements, and contact a reputable personal injury attorney as soon as possible. These steps will help strengthen your case and protect your legal rights. |
6. Can I still pursue a personal injury claim if I was partially at fault for the accident? | Absolutely! In California, you can still pursue a personal injury claim even if you were partially at fault for the accident. The state follows a comparative negligence system, where your compensation is reduced based on your percentage of fault. |
7. What types of damages can I seek in a personal injury lawsuit? | In a personal injury lawsuit, you can seek economic damages (such as medical expenses and lost wages) and non-economic damages (such as pain and suffering and emotional distress). The goal recover compensation losses suffered due injury. |
8. How long does it take to settle a personal injury case? | The duration of a personal injury case varies depending on various factors, such as the complexity of the case, the willingness of the insurance company to negotiate, and the need for litigation. Some cases can be resolved in a few months, while others may take years. |
9. Can I handle a personal injury claim without hiring an attorney? | Well, you can technically handle a personal injury claim without an attorney, but it`s not recommended. An experienced attorney can navigate the complex legal process, negotiate with insurance companies, and advocate for your best interests, ultimately maximizing your chances of obtaining fair compensation. |
10. How much does it cost to hire a personal injury attorney in San Diego? | Most personal injury attorneys in San Diego work on a contingency fee basis, which means they only get paid if they secure a favorable outcome for your case. This fee is typically a percentage of the final settlement or court award, making legal representation accessible to individuals from all walks of life. |
